Your Blank Canvas Awaits in the Heart of It All. Nestled in one of the area’s most desirable neighborhoods, this shovel-ready vacant lot offers an unparalleled opportunity to craft the home of your dreams. Spanning an impressive 50 feet wide and 165 feet deep, this 8, 292 sq. ft. parcel is a rare find for those seeking space, location, and limitless potential. A lifestyle of convenience is at your doorstep—just a short stroll to both private and public schools, an organic co-op grocery, bustling farmers’ markets, stylish salons, boutique theaters, and an eclectic array of shopping and dining options. The downtown buzz, serene TART trail, and the shimmering bay are all within blocks, making this location truly unmatched. With R-1b zoning, the lot accommodates two structures and offers ample flexibility to create your vision, with generous setbacks and a maximum build height of 35 feet. The home has already been removed, and the site is primed for your masterpiece. Whether you’re envisioning a sleek modern sanctuary or a charming coastal retreat, this is your chance to design a space that reflects your style and captures the essence of a vibrant, walkable community.

About Old Town

The Old Town Neighborhood in Downtown Traverse City is a unique residential area with many local corner shops, markets, cafés, and more tucked away inside of it - this neighborhood is highly-desired.   

Plus, Old Town neighborhood has the TART trail running right through it!   

Historically, commercial industry has operated in Old Town, and many neighborhood retail stores and markets remain.  Visit Oryana Natural Foods Market, a much-larger-than-expected cooperative grocery store with ready foods, produce, and natural and organic foods of many flavors and cultures.  Deering's Market and Deli, Old Town Playhouse, Blue Tractor, and more are here and ready to be explored!
